/e/ develops and sells de-googlised Android smartphones. You can follow at:

āž”ļø @e_mydata

Their website is at e.foundation and their phone shop is at esolutions.shop

The /e/ version of Android can also be self-installed onto your existing device.

One of the models with /e/ preinstalled is the @Fairphone, which is built as ethically as possible (fair wages & working conditions, recycled materials etc).

The feature that made Waze more popular than Google maps until Google bought them was the crowdsourced identification of speed traps.
osm.org has the ability to log face traps (surveillance/facial recognition cameras). I have been mapping them as points of type: surveillance.
Some mobile mapping apps such as could show these features to help us know how to safely navigate around town. Edit your neighborhood maps.
